1.选择连接方式
2.安装openssh-server
sudo apt install openssh-server
3. 修改
sudo gedit /etc/ssh/sshd_config
在这里加入
PermitRootLogin yes
4. IP 设置
打开cmd通过ipconfg查看当前宿主机的ip信息
根据宿主机的配置信息设置Ubuntu的netplan配置文件
sudo gedit /etc/netplan/01-network-manager-all.yaml
network:
ethernets:
enp0s3: # 网卡名
dhcp4: false # 设置为静态,如果动态改为true,下面的参数都不需要设置了
addresses: [192.168.43.182/24] # 地址和子网掩码,注意地址段应该与宿主机一致
gateway4: 192.168.43.1 # 默认网关,与宿主机一致
nameservers:
addresses: [8.8.8.8,114.114.114.114] # DNS
version: 2
我这里使用动态的
修改完成之后,需要
sudo netplan apply
5.查询ip
ifconfig
6. 检查虚拟机和主机之间是否可以互相ping
7. 尝试sftp连接
选择一个连接软件,选择SFTP,输入虚拟机IP,用户名输入注册时的名字,输入密码。
连接成功